Understanding Emergency Repairs
Emergency repairs are unexpected repairs that need immediate attention to prevent further damage or risk. They can happen in numerous settings, consisting of residential homes, commercial properties, and public spaces. The most common kinds of emergency repairs often involve pipes, electrical issues, roofing system leaks, and HVAC (heating, ventilation, and cooling) problems.

Step 1: Assess the Situation
Recognize the problem and assess the intensity. Is it a small leak or a major flooding concern? Security is the very first concern.
Step 2: Shut Off Utilities
If the circumstance includes water or gas, turned off the suitable utility to avoid further damage.
Step 3: Contain the Problem
If possible, consist of the concern. For example, place pails under leaks or cover electric outlets with plastic if flooding looms.
Step 4: Call a Professional
Contact your trusted repair specialists. Offer them with all the essential info, including the nature of the problem, any efforts made to solve it, and the seriousness of the scenario.
Step 5: Document the Damage
Take images and keep records of the damage for insurance coverage functions. This paperwork can also help the repair specialists understand the extent of the concern.
Action 6: Prevent Future Issues
After the repairs, consider what preventative procedures you can carry out. For instance, schedule routine upkeep checks for home appliances or upgrade old electrical systems.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)What makes up an emergency repair?
An emergency repair is any unforeseen concern that needs immediate attention to avoid more damage, injury, or danger.
How can I discover a trusted repair professional?
Try to find suggestions from friends, read online reviews, and validate licenses and insurance coverage before employing a repair professional.
Should I try to repair emergency situations myself?
Just effort repairs if you have the knowledge and tools to do so securely. Constantly prioritize safety over cost savings.
How can I avoid emergency repairs?
Routine maintenance, inspections, and addressing small issues promptly can substantially minimize the likelihood of emergency situations.
Is homeowners insurance coverage enough to cover emergency repairs?
While property owners insurance often covers some emergency repairs, it's vital to examine your policy and understand what is covered to avoid unanticipated costs.
